Output e65b5bcf6864b0b9752cf9fcbee128768bddbb4069481637c3137ba2ae6c1fca:0

value
16425972
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d3abefde669f2dfdd80754fe621883bda1e1ca2 OP_EQUALVERIFY OP_CHECKSIG
address
19VxDb7YxooNMC146WAW3ZU9W3u71i4oak
transaction
e65b5bcf6864b0b9752cf9fcbee128768bddbb4069481637c3137ba2ae6c1fca
confirmations
353195
spent
true